Permanent - Part Time (Reduced hours across 4 or 5 days) Hereford 26,000-29,000 per annum (pro rata)

Are you driven by precision, trusted with sensitive information, and motivated by knowing your work keeps an organisation running smoothly? I am recruiting a diligent and accurate Payroll Administrator to join the Finance function of a rapidly evolving business. This opportunity is ideal for an experienced payroll professional seeking reduced hours while still playing a key role in a multi-entity payroll operation. The role will be office based initially, with the option to work up to 2 days per week from home once fully trained.

This is a position where your judgement, discretion, and analytical strength will be relied upon daily. You’ll work with autonomy, influence, and the confidence of senior stakeholders.

What you’ll be responsible for:

  • Multi cycle payroll processing - weekly, fortnightly, and monthly runs, including mileage and expenses
  • Payroll accuracy to expert for payroll queries
  • Finance team collaboration - providing cover and contributing to continuous improvement

What you’ll bring:

  • Minimum 2 years payroll experience
  • Strong Microsoft Office skills
  • Exceptional organisational ability
  • A calm, confident approach to deadlines
